Dinosaur Park Trips

As part of Bielefeld School’s Science Week, the children of FS2 and Year 2 will be investigating dinosaurs. To make their investigations even more enjoyable, we are planning 2 visits to Dinopark.

Dinopark is a dinosaur open air museum, near Hannover. There are naturally preserved dinosaurs tracks (discovered in 1987) as well as life size models, spread around wooded park land. There are also opportunities for the children to do some excavating!

Further information can be found at www.dinopark.de

We plan to take the FS2 children on Thu 12 Jul and Year 2 children on Wed 11 Jul. The buses will leave school shortly after 9am and return shortly before 3pm on each day. The cost for this trip will be €10.

Sun Dialling

It's almost the Summer Solstice in the Northern Hemisphere, and Year 3's children have been tracking the Earth's movement around the Sun, by drawing around their shadows at set time intervals.

Shadow Outlines

The children have also been learning about light, as well as transparent and opaque materials.

Do Try This At Home

Place 3 Skittles, apart from one another, in a saucer of cold water, preferably a white saucer.

Watch what happens over the next half an hour and work out what is happening. Talk to your mum, dad, carer, big brother or big sister, if you get stuck.

Does the same behaviour occur with Smarties? Tell your teacher what you think is happening.
